Poor Infiltration

Poor infiltration occurs when the weld metal falls short to totally fuse with the base product, leading to weak joints and prospective architectural failings. This problem frequently comes from inadequate warmth input, incorrect electrode angle, or inappropriate welding rate. Welders might experience poor penetration because of a mistake of the necessary parameters for a details product density or kind. Furthermore, contamination on the base material's surface can prevent reliable bonding, exacerbating the issue. To address inadequate penetration, welders must ensure ideal setups on their devices and preserve a clean work surface area. Routine examination of welds is advised to identify any deficiencies early, permitting timely modifications and the prevention of compromised structural integrity in welded assemblies.

Porosity

Porosity is an usual problem in welded joints that shows up as small gas bubbles entraped within the weld steel. Porosity typically develops from contamination, wetness, or incorrect welding techniques, which enable gases to run away right into the liquified weld pool. To resolve porosity, welders must assure appropriate surface area preparation, maintain a tidy workplace, and utilize ideal welding specifications. Additionally, choosing the appropriate filler material and securing gas can reduce gas entrapment. Normal examination and screening of welds can assist determine porosity early, guaranteeing prompt rehabilitative activities are taken, consequently preserving the quality and integrity of the welded framework

Distortion

Distortion is a typical challenge in welding that can emerge from different factors, consisting of irregular heating & cooling. Recognizing the causes of distortion is necessary for applying efficient prevention techniques. Addressing this problem not just improves architectural honesty but additionally enhances the total high quality of the weld.

Reasons for Distortion

When based on the extreme warm of welding, materials usually undergo adjustments that can result in distortion. This sensation largely occurs from thermal growth and tightening during the welding process. As the weld location heats up, the material broadens; upon air conditioning, it acquires, which can produce inner stresses. In addition, unequal home heating throughout a workpiece can intensify these anxieties, leading to bending or bending. The type of material also plays a considerable function; steels with varying thermal conductivity and coefficients of expansion may react in different ways, resulting in unforeseeable distortions. Inadequate joint style and insufficient fixturing can add to misalignment during welding, raising the possibility of distortion. Comprehending these causes is vital for effective welding repair and prevention techniques.


Prevention Techniques

Effective avoidance methods for distortion during welding focus on controlling warmth input and ensuring appropriate joint style. Keeping find more a consistent warm input helps to reduce thermal development and tightening, which can result in distortion. Making use of strategies such as pre-heating the workpiece can also lower the temperature level gradient, advertising consistent heating. In addition, selecting appropriate joint styles, such as T-joints or lap joints, can boost stability and reduce stress and anxiety focus. Applying proper fixturing to secure the workpieces in area additionally help in preserving alignment throughout the welding process. Lastly, staggered welding series can distribute warmth much more equally, stopping local distortion. By using these approaches, welders can considerably lower the probability of distortion and enhance the general top quality of their welds.

Fracturing

Breaking is a common issue come across in welding repairs, usually arising from various aspects such as improper air conditioning rates, product option, or poor joint preparation. The event of fractures can considerably compromise the honesty of the weld, bring about prospective failures during procedure. To resolve this problem, welders must first evaluate the root creates, guaranteeing that materials are compatible and appropriately selected for the particular application. In addition, regulating the cooling rate throughout the welding process is crucial; fast cooling can generate anxiety and bring about cracking. Correct joint layout and preparation also contribute to lessening the danger. Executing these methods can boost weld top quality and longevity, eventually minimizing the possibility of breaking in completed weldments.

Overheating

While welding repair work can boost structural stability, overheating offers a substantial difficulty that can result in product degradation. Excessive warm during welding can alter the mechanical homes of metals, leading to lowered stamina, raised brittleness, and warping. This sensation is specifically essential in high-stress applications where architectural integrity is critical. Recognizing overheating can involve aesthetic examinations for staining or distortion, in addition to keeping an eye on temperature level throughout the welding process. To reduce the dangers connected with getting too hot, welders need to utilize appropriate techniques, such as regulating warmth input, changing traveling speed, and making use of ideal filler products. Furthermore, carrying out pre- and post-weld warmth therapies can assist bring back material residential or commercial properties and improve the total quality of the repair, ensuring long-lasting efficiency and security.
